Position Summary:

We are hiring a Sourcing Manager. As a Sourcing Manager, you will play a pivotal role in strengthening Xylem’s supply base, optimizing total cost of ownership, and delivering materials and services that enable manufacturing excellence and long-term competitiveness. The Sourcing Program Manager is responsible for developing and executing sourcing strategies that align with business objectives and support new product introduction (NPI), cost reduction, supplier quality and capability. This role manages the end-to-end strategic sourcing lifecycle, including supplier evaluation, contract negotiation, supplier development, and performance improvement.

This individual will lead cross-functional initiatives with Engineering, Operations, Quality, and Procurement teams to ensure a best-in-class, risk-mitigated, and value-driven supply base.

Key Responsibilities:

Sourcing Strategy

  • Develop and implement commodity sourcing strategies aligned with global supply chain and product roadmap objectives.
  • Drive sourcing projects and ensure they are completed on time, within scope, and within
  • Monitor industry trends and identify sourcing opportunities that support cost competitiveness and innovation.

Supplier Development

  • Identify and onboard high-performing suppliers to support business growth and mitigate risk.
  • Collaborate with Quality and Operations to elevate supplier capabilities and ensure alignment with Xylem’s performance standards.

Supply Base Optimization

  • Rationalize and consolidate the supplier base to reduce complexity and leverage economies of scale.
  • Support dual-sourcing strategies and risk mitigation plans across key commodities and regions.

Negotiations & Agreements

  • Lead supplier negotiations on pricing, terms, lead times, and contracts to drive favorable commercial outcomes.
  • Develop, execute, and manage supplier agreements, including long-term supply and development contracts.

Pricing Maintenance & Cost Reduction

  • Provide accurate pricing data for ERP systems and ensure alignment with contracts and forecasts.
  • Lead cost reduction initiatives through value engineering, volume leverage, and alternative sourcing.

Supplier Selection & Assessment

  • Responsible for awarding business to qualified suppliers to meet business need in alignment with engineering, quality and supply chain strategies and policies
  • Execute fair and competitive sourcing processes (RFQ/RFP) and facilitate award decisions based on TCO (Total Cost of Ownership).
  • Align sourcing strategy with financial, operational and risk mitigation goals.
  • Collaborate with suppliers and Category Management to ensure production capacity meets current and forecast demand.
  • Lead supplier assessments, audits, and qualifications for new and existing suppliers.

Existing supplier capacity assessment

  • Collaborate with suppliers and Category Management to ensure production capacity meets current and forecast demand.
  • Anticipate and resolve bottlenecks or constraints that may impact delivery timelines.

Technology Roadmaps & Benchmarking

  • Align supplier capabilities with product and technology roadmaps to drive innovation.
  • Conduct benchmarking studies to evaluate market competitiveness of supplier pricing and services.

High-Level Expediting

  • Support the procurement team in escalated material delays by driving quick-turn supplier engagement and recovery planning.
  • Support Operations and Logistics on mission-critical supply continuity.

RFQ for New Parts & NPI Support

  • Lead sourcing activities for new components, prototypes, and early-phase production tied to New Product Introductions (NPIs).
  • Engage early with Engineering and Program Management to align sourcing plans with product timelines.

Supplier Business Reviews & Improvement

  • Participate in periodic supplier business reviews focused on performance, risk, capacity, and collaboration opportunities.
  • Support continuous improvement plans for underperforming suppliers and manage corrective actions.

Approved Supplier List & Preferred Part List

  • Maintain and enforce compliance with the Approved Supplier List (ASL) and Preferred Part List (PPL).
  • Partner with Engineering and Quality to update supplier and part approvals as needed.

Supplied Material Quality

  • Work with suppliers and Quality to mitigate critical supplier quality events.
  • Maintain the tooling and equipment asset management database.
